1973 Chevrolet Corvette 'Survivor'! This is a true barn find car that had been
sitting for years. Would you believe this car is still wearing its original paint? It is!
You can see the factory bonding strips on the front and back of this car. Corvette
enthusiasts know how important this is. Even the dealer sticker is still on the back.
Original door vin stickers are still there too. That is what I like best about it. No
after market front clip, no bondo hiding damage, no crappy paint job that you
would have to strip and re paint. The frame is nice and solid too. It is a 350 non
original motor 4 speed car. The original M-21 4 speed is in the car (matching
vin#). Car runs and drives. I just replaced all the brakes with new rotors, calipers,
hoses, and master cylinder. Brakes work great. Now that I have said all that. The
car does need 'Total' restoration. I removed most of the interior pieces, most not
restorable. I did keep them and they come with the car. Seats need repairing and
re upholstering. There is some small rust areas in the doors. Nothing that is not
repairable. The front bumper was dry rotted and I replaced it with a brand new
Tru flex front bumper. This is great car to restore. I am sure I am forgetting to
